Filing a Lawsuit

Mesothelioma compensation may assist victims with medical expenses, funeral expenses and lost income from work. It can also allow families to live in comfort when a loved one is sick and dying. The mesothelioma law firms which are highly experienced in asbestos litigation will manage the legal process so clients and their families don't have to worry about it.

A competent lawyer will gather the evidence needed to prove the case and file an action. This can take up to several months. However, mesothelioma lawyers typically know how to expedite the legal process so that patients receive compensation earlier rather than later.

Mesothelioma lawsuits can be filed under personal injury laws or wrongful death laws. There could be multiple defendants involved, since asbestos companies are well-known for providing various asbestos-related products to different states. Mesothelioma lawyers will review the asbestos companies' corporate documents to determine where Asbestos Lawyer exposure occurred and when. They will then determine the best state to file the claim.

Lawsuits can be settled out of court or brought to trial. Most mesothelioma cases can be settled outside of the courtroom. This is due to the fact that most of the time asbestos companies are unable to defend themselves against a mesothelioma suit and they will agree to pay compensation to victims to avoid an extended trial.

The jury will decide on the amount each victim is entitled to when a lawsuit is tried. Damages are usually divided into two categories: economic and noneconomic. Economic damages refer to documented treatment costs as well as loss of wages and other expenses that are substantiated with the diagnosis. Noneconomic damages are based on the plaintiff's pain and suffering and can be awarded in addition to the economic damages awards.
